Abstract:
PURPOSE: A wi-media resource reservation method for constructing a wi-media network is provided to reserve other links by passing through a relay device or a direct link. CONSTITUTION: When data is transmitted and received in an MAS(medium access slot) S-R(S518), a DRP(distributed reservation protocol) IE(information element) for a reservation target node set as a reservation detail state code of a relay notification is confirmed(S522). It is determined whether the data is transmitted and received through an MAS R-T(S524). When a relay node is able to use the MAS S-R and the MAS R-T, MAS R-T information for continuously transmitting the data is stored(S526). The DRP IE set as a relay approval reservation state code is transmitted to a reservation subject node(S528). Abstract:
PURPOSE: A method for efficiently reusing and managing a frequency by utilizing a seaway mark identification device for marine telematics is provided to supply a frequency reuse method and a frequency utilization method between users in an integrated model which is connected to a land mobile communication system based on OFDM(Orthogonal Frequency Division Multiplexing). CONSTITUTION: A frequency is divided corresponding to distance and is reused. The frequency is assigned to a seaway mark identification device with a CR(Cognitive Radio) function to be reused. A frequency, which use frequency is low, and another frequency which interference is not reached are utilized as a CR frequency. The frequencies are assigned per timeslot. The frequencies are reused in the whole frequency environment. Abstract:
PURPOSE: A method and an apparatus of ship-borne using a WIBRO uplink frame are provided to prevent the collision of vessel AIS data. CONSTITUTION: A ship-borne device receives AIS data from two or more vessels and senses the collision of vessel AIS data. A collision time slot is transmitted to a land base station through a WiBro channel. A sub channel is allocated by using FLR(Full Loading Range) algorithm.
Abstract:
PURPOSE: A motor control system for an electric engine ship using wind power is provided to minimize fuel consumption used in sailing by guiding efficient energy consumption of a ship using electricity as power source. CONSTITUTION: A motor control system for an electric engine ship using wind power comprises an anemoscope/anemometer(110), a controller(120), a context aware control algorithm(130), a transmission(140), and an electric engine(150). The anemoscope/anemometer measures effects of wind blowing to a ship. The controller receives data from the anemoscope/anemometer to control relevant equipment. The context aware control algorithm receives the wind power data from the controller to control power of an engine and a transmission using context aware control algorithm. The transmission controls speed of the ship according to determination of the context aware control algorithm. The electric engine controls power of the engine according to the determination of the context aware control algorithm.
Abstract:
PURPOSE: A method for improving WiMedia network performance for a vessel network is provided to prevent and solve new DRP(Distributed Reservation Protocol) reservation collision by using a 2-hop DRP availability IE(Information Element) and a DRP control field in a vessel network environment. CONSTITUTION: A DRP target receives a 2-hop DRP availability IE from 1-hop distance devices. The 2-hop DRP availability IE includes a bitmap field which is composed of 256 bits corresponding to an MAS(Medium Access Slot) in a super frame. When DRP reservation for a 2-hop distance device is possible, the DRP target sets a bit corresponding to the MAS as 1. The DRP target sets the remaining bits as 0.
Abstract:
PURPOSE: A DRP(Distribution and Replication Protocol) reservation diversity method based on cooperative relay communication is provided to maintain reserved resources by reserving an indirect link which passes through a relay device. CONSTITUTION: If a first indirect path and a second indirect path are able to be reserved, a reservation subject node transmits a reservation detailed state code to a relay node(S44). The relay node transmits the set reservation detailed state code by notifying a relay state to a reservation target node. The reservation subject node transmits the detailed reservation state code to the reservation target node. The reservation subject node receives the set detailed reservation state code. The reservation subject node transmits data via a direct path which is arranged to the reservation target node(S46).
Abstract:
PURPOSE: A network service quality guarantee method in a ship is provided to set variables of RIO(RED(Random Early Detection) with In and Out) again by considering the maximum rate of the whole packets in fixed time sections. CONSTITUTION: A buffer size is determined by being allocated according to a network topology and an AS(Assured Service) sub-class. The variable values of the RIO are set by considering the whole packets and profile packets based on the determined buffer size in fixed time sections. When the profile packets and the whole packets are arrived, the number of the profile packets is determined in the fixed time sections according to the number of the whole packets.
